In this way, the pictorial film becomes extremely lively and alive, in a landscape lyricism that thrives not only on the perfection of the naturalistic rendering, but also on the expressive power of color and painterly gesture.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\n\u003cp\u003e Giuseppe Arigliano was born in 1917 in Genoa, where he lived and worked as a professional painter from 1946 until his death in 1999. After attending courses at the Linguistic Academy of Fine Arts in his hometown, he participated in numerous important national and international exhibitions and shows, earning awards and mentions.\u003cbr\u003e \nHe has held solo exhibitions in various Italian cities, receiving both public and critical acclaim. His paintings are highly regarded and admired by highly respected art experts. His works are also held in public and private collections, both nationally and internationally, as well as on the Italian Navy's frigates, \"Zeffiro,\" \"Scirocco,\" \"Sibilla,\" \"Vieste,\" and others.\u003cbr\u003e\n From 1967 to 1989 he took part in numerous events, winning many awards, particularly in the exhibitions organised on board the cruise ships of the Costa Armatori company of Genoa.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Ristagno Salvatore","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":56218710278530,"sku":"SRIS003","price":3500.0,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0909\/7065\/3058\/files\/Arigliano.jpg?v=1768475955","url":"https:\/\/cjfh11-ee.myshopify.com\/en\/products\/arigliano-calma-nel-torrente","provider":"Venderequadri","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
